As used in this chapter, unless the context otherwise requires:

(1) “Board” means the board of dietitian/nutritionist examiners;

(2) “Department” means the department of health;
(3) “Dietetics/nutrition practice” means the integration and application of scientific principles of food, nutrition, biochemistry, physiology, management and behavioral and social sciences in achieving and maintaining health through the life cycle and in the treatment of disease. Methods of practice include, but are not limited to, nutritional assessment, development, implementation and evaluation of nutrition care plans, nutritional counseling and education, and the development and administration of nutrition care standards and systems;
(4) “Dietitian” and “nutritionist” may be used interchangeably;
(5) “Dietitian/nutritionist” means a health care professional practicing dietetics/nutrition and licensed under this chapter; and
(6) “Division” means the division of health related boards within the department.
